Key Responsibilities:
- Simulate real-world retail environments in our retail lab and conduct in-person testing in stores to validate software used by store associates.
- Test omni-channel and retail operations workflows such as BOPIS, BORIS, Endless Aisle, Membership, Store Fulfillment, inventory adjustments, order exceptions, returns, and ERP-connected processes.
- Test associate-facing applications on iPads, including interactions with payment terminals, checkout pinpads, and other connected peripherals.
- Collaborate with Quality Engineers on eCommerce and retail teams to execute end-to-end testing that spans from in-store systems to ERP and fulfillment platforms.
- Use AI tools to accelerate test design, exploratory testing, defect analysis, documentation, and test reporting.
- Learn and apply modern test automation tools and scripting languages to support test execution and reporting.
- Configure and troubleshoot retail hardware setups including POS terminals, scanners, printers, mobile devices, and payment systems.
- Participate in agile ceremonies and contribute to quality discussions within a Scaled Agile Framework (SAFe) environment.
- Act as a retail subject matter expert, bringing frontline and back-office retail operations insights into the testing process to ensure software meets the needs of store associates, retail operations teams, inventory and fulfillment teams, finance and reconciliation teams, and customers.
